The use of antibiotics across the world in the past decade has affect the development of antibiotic resistance not only by pathogenic bacteria but also commensal bacteria. This is an alarming subject, since any infection caused by commensal bacteria which supposed to be easily treated might become a life-threatening condition. Streptococcus pneumoniae causes many diseases with a high burden worldwide, such as pneumonia, especially in developing countries including Indonesia. Moreover, S. pneumoniae has been reported to produce biofilms that have been linked to antibiotic resistance, stronger immune evasion, and persistent infection.
